3. Grumpy Cat

I know Grumpy Cat is still "around" and got his own movie, but it's just not like it used to be. I am not sure it ever will be again. As someone who is particularly grumpy, I just miss the relatability of it all.

4. Left Shark

Speaking of relatability, we all know a Left Shark in our lives. Maybe we all are the Left Shark in our lives. It's fine. With his sick moves, Left Shark stole the show in Katy Perry's Super Bowl performance. Our shining light in a dark time.
